Alfred3
Alfred3 - A library for rapid experiment development
Alfred3 is a package for Python 3 offering experimenters a fast and easy way to create truly dynamic computer experiments for a wide range of applications. See http://www.the-experimenter.com/framework for more information.
If you are publishing research conducted using Alfred3, please cite:
Treffenstaedt, C., Wiemann, P. & Brachem, J. (2020). Alfred3 - A library for rapid experiment development (Version 1.1.0). Göttingen, Germany: https://doi.org/10.5281/zenodo.1437219
Installation
If you have Python 3 installed, you can install alfred3 via pip with the follwoing command. It is best practice to install alfred3 in a new virtual environment for every project (see virtualenv package).
pip install alfred3
